Australian NAB Business Confidence Rebounds in May, But Sentiment Remains Negative

Australia’s NAB Business Confidence index showed a notable improvement in May 2026, rising to -14 from April’s deeply negative reading of -24, according to data updated on 9 June 2026. While the indicator remains below zero—signaling that pessimists still outnumber optimists across the corporate sector—the 10-point jump suggests that sentiment is stabilizing after a weaker April.

The move from -24 to -14 indicates that businesses are becoming less downbeat about operating conditions and the outlook, even though they have not yet shifted into positive territory. The negative level of the index underscores ongoing concerns about demand, costs, or broader economic uncertainty, but the direction of change points to easing pessimism as firms reassess prospects heading into the second half of 2026.

Market participants and policymakers are likely to view the May reading as an early sign that business confidence may be turning a corner, while remaining cautious about the still-fragile mood. Further monthly improvements will be needed to confirm a sustained trend away from the pronounced weakness seen in April.
